They are books that arrived by different paths. Some come from the old colonial Bartoline library, which was not part of the expropriations of the time; others returned to the Jesuits after the expulsions; others were acquired expressly to complete or enrich the collections; others are the product of generous bequests or donations.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\n \u003cp\u003eThere are representative specimens of the humanistic or scholastic tradition and of marginal authors in that tradition, such as Ramón Llull or Justo Lipsio. There are novel works for their time, such as the texts of Christian Wolff, a great popularizer of rationalism in the 18th century. There are complete editions of the sources of Roman and canon law, and of commentators on both these rights and Spanish law. There are also copies of Grotius and Pufendorf, the Protestant natural lawyers of the 17th century.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\n\u003cp\u003e In short, an extraordinary example of the desire to disseminate knowledge, an invaluable and beautiful set of that admirable object of culture that is the book.\u003c\/p\u003e","brand":"Villegas Asociados S.A","offers":[{"title":"Default Title","offer_id":31544382226490,"sku":"9789588306735","price":180000.0,"currency_code":"COP","in_stock":true}],"thumbnail_url":"\/\/cdn.shopify.com\/s\/files\/1\/0258\/8924\/3194\/products\/Libro_de_los_libros_II.jpg?v=1598895208"},{"product_id":"el-mundo-del-arte-en-san-agustin","title":"The Art World in San Agustín","description":"\u003cmeta charset=\"utf-8\"\u003e\n\n \u003cp\u003e\u003cstrong\u003e\u003cfont style=\"vertical-align: inherit;\"\u003e\u003cfont style=\"vertical-align: inherit;\"\u003eAlso available in English with the title:\u003c\/font\u003e\u003c\/font\u003e\u003c\/strong\u003e \u003ca href=\"https:\/\/villegaseditores.com\/products\/the-world-of-art-in-san-agustin\" title=\"The art world in San Agustín\"\u003e\u003cfont style=\"vertical-align: inherit;\"\u003e\u003cfont style=\"vertical-align: inherit;\"\u003eThe art world in San Agustín\u003c\/font\u003e\u003c\/font\u003e\u003c\/a\u003e\u003c\/p\u003e\n\n\u003cp\u003e \u003ca href=\"https:\/\/villegaseditores.com\/products\/the-world-of-art-in-san-agustin\" title=\"The art world in San Agustín\"\u003e\u003cimg src=\"https:\/\/cdn.shopify.com\/s\/files\/1\/0258\/8924\/3194\/files\/theworldofart_240x240.jpg?v=1598332894\" alt=\"\" style=\"display: block; The fifth and last is Santo Domingo, patron saint of Managua, a gift that Maruca made to the Santo Domingo neighborhood, where she lives.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\n \u003cp\u003eAs a working system in the case of the heads, Maruca begins by modeling the clay from photographs, and when the head is advanced he finishes it with the present model. Then it goes on to make the mold and the figure in plaster to, finally, send it to Costa Rica, where the bronze casting process is carried out.\u003c\/p\u003e","brand":"Villegas Asociados S.A","offers":[{"title":"Default Title","offer_id":31544387698746,"sku":"9789588818429","price":219000.0,"currency_code":"COP","in_stock":true}],"thumbnail_url":"\/\/cdn.shopify.com\/s\/files\/1\/0258\/8924\/3194\/products\/Maruca_Gomez.jpg?v=1598895231"},{"product_id":"mauricio-gomez-with-the-left-hand","title":"Mauricio Gomez, with the left hand","description":"\u003cmeta charset=\"utf-8\"\u003e\n\n \u003cp\u003e\u003cstrong\u003e\u003cspan style=\"vertical-align: inherit;\"\u003e\u003cspan style=\"vertical-align: inherit;\"\u003eAlso available in French with the title:\u003c\/span\u003e\u003c\/span\u003e\u003c\/strong\u003e \u003cspan style=\"vertical-align: inherit;\"\u003e\u003cspan style=\"vertical-align: inherit;\"\u003eMauricio Gómez - De la Main Gauche\u003c\/span\u003e\u003c\/span\u003e\u003c\/p\u003e\n\n\u003cp\u003e \u003ca title=\"Mauricio Gomez\" href=\"https:\/\/villegaseditores.com\/products\/mauricio-gomez-with-the-left-hand-frances?_pos=1\u0026amp;_sid=008fcffa9\u0026amp;_ss=r\"\u003e\u003cimg style=\"display: block; margin-left: auto; margin-right: auto;\" alt=\"Mauricio Gomez, De La Main Gouche\" src=\"https:\/\/cdn.shopify.com\/s\/files\/1\/0258\/8924\/3194\/files\/mauricio_gomez_gauche_160x160.jpg?v=1598889782\"\u003e\u003c\/a\u003e\u003c\/p\u003e\n\n\u003cp\u003e \u003cspan style=\"vertical-align: inherit;\"\u003e\u003cspan style=\"vertical-align: inherit;\"\u003eMauricio Gómez, a born fighter, is also an unusual, unique, unrepeatable artist.\u003c\/span\u003e\u003c\/span\u003e\u003c\/p\u003e\n\n \u003cp\u003e\u003cspan style=\"vertical-align: inherit;\"\u003e\u003cspan style=\"vertical-align: inherit;\"\u003eThis book includes a final selection of the works carried out by the artist in recent years, starting from the unfortunate moment when he lost the movement of his right hand and had to necessarily enable his left hand for plastic creation.\u003c\/span\u003e \u003cspan style=\"vertical-align: inherit;\"\u003eForced by these circumstances to put aside the use of oil paint, a technique in which he had worked with enormous productivity until then, Mauricio Gómez began to devise, explore, discover and take advantage, with the fruitful results that this book shows, other techniques, such as collage and drawing, and other materials, such as pigments and erasers.\u003c\/span\u003e\u003c\/span\u003e\u003c\/p\u003e\n\n\u003cp\u003e \u003cspan style=\"vertical-align: inherit;\"\u003e\u003cspan style=\"vertical-align: inherit;\"\u003eThis volume is an admirable example of a talent, a will and a vocation that is unbreakable.\u003c\/span\u003e\u003c\/span\u003e\u003c\/p\u003e","brand":"Villegas Asociados S.A","offers":[{"title":"Default Title","offer_id":31942443335738,"sku":"9789588156286","price":180000.0,"currency_code":"COP","in_stock":true}],"thumbnail_url":"\/\/cdn.shopify.com\/s\/files\/1\/0258\/8924\/3194\/products\/mauricio-left-hand.jpg?v=1598895232"},{"product_id":"monica-meira","title":"Monica Meira","description":"\u003cp\u003e Mónica Meira—painter, draftsman, portraitist and engraver—is the artist to whom, in 2010, Seguros Bolívar dedicated its annual book on outstanding figures of Colombian art.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\n\u003cp\u003e A disciple of great masters such as Juan Antonio Roda, Santiago Cárdenas, Juan Cárdenas, Carlos Rojas, Luis Caballero, Nirma Zárate and Umberto Giangrandi, among others, the work of Mónica Meira emerged in the country's plastic environment in the seventies, very shortly after to complete his studies at the Universidad de los Andes.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\n \u003cp\u003eHer initial pop works are followed by a stage in which the artist recreates unforgettable objects, almost always feminine—bags, gloves, boots, purses—and exquisite fabrics of great craftsmanship and beauty in which her enjoyment of textures is evident. and the nuances. This is stated in the texts of Professor Germán Rubiano Caballero.\u003c\/p\u003e","brand":"Villegas Asociados S.A","offers":[{"title":"Default Title","offer_id":31544387993658,"sku":"9789588306599","price":219000.0,"currency_code":"COP","in_stock":true}],"thumbnail_url":"\/\/cdn.shopify.com\/s\/files\/1\/0258\/8924\/3194\/products\/monicameira.jpg?v=1598895234"},{"product_id":"richter","title":"Leopoldo Richter","description":"\u003cp\u003eThe case of Leopoldo Richter is exceptional in Colombian art. German by origin, Colombian by vocation, cosmopolitan by artist and scientist by training, Richter arrived in Colombia in 1935 and stayed there until his death. Inspired by his frequent trips to the jungle \"in his capacity as an entomologist, professor at the National University, Richter ends up giving free rein to his artistic sensitivity, in drawings, watercolors, paintings and enamel mosaics on ceramic tiles. Without allowing himself to be pigeonholed into none of the artistic trends of his time, Richter offers his artistic tribute to the American race and the magical and unfathomable nature that surrounds him in a way that only he knew how to do. Leopoldo Richter's passage through Colombian art cannot be indifferent to No art lover. As the Italian critic Vittorio Sgardi, cited by Beatriz González in his text, pointed out, the National Museum of Colombia is \"the best way to understand Botero.\" \u003c\/p\u003e\n\n\u003ch3\u003e\n\n\u003ca href=\"https:\/\/villegaseditores.com\/botero-in-the-museo-nacional-de-colombia-new-donation-2004\"\u003e\u003c\/a\u003e\u003cbr\u003e\n\n\u003c\/h3\u003e","brand":"Villegas Editores S.A","offers":[{"title":"Default Title","offer_id":31907386359866,"sku":"9799588156490","price":258000.0,"currency_code":"COP","in_stock":true}],"thumbnail_url":"\/\/cdn.shopify.com\/s\/files\/1\/0258\/8924\/3194\/products\/botero-museo-nacional.jpg?v=1597894879"},{"product_id":"the-journey-of-frederic-edwin-church","title":"The Journey of Frederic Edwin Church","description":"\u003cmeta charset=\"utf-8\"\u003e\n\n\u003cp\u003e \u003cstrong\u003eAlso available in Spanish with the title:\u003c\/strong\u003e \u003ca href=\"https:\/\/villegaseditores.com\/products\/el-viaje-de-frederic-edwin-church-por-colombia-y-ecuador-abril-octubre-de-1853\" title=\"The Journey of Frederic Edwin Church\"\u003eThe Journey of Frederic Edwin Church - Through Colombia and Ecuador April - October 1853\u003c\/a\u003e\u003c\/p\u003e\n\n\u003cp\u003e \u003ca href=\"https:\/\/villegaseditores.com\/products\/el-viaje-de-frederic-edwin-church-por-colombia-y-ecuador-abril-octubre-de-1853\" title=\"The Journey of Frederic Edwin Church\"\u003e\u003cimg src=\"https:\/\/cdn.shopify.com\/s\/files\/1\/0258\/8924\/3194\/files\/FredericChurch_240x240.jpg?v=1597962605\" alt=\"\" style=\"display: block; margin-left: auto; margin-right: auto;\"\u003e\u003c\/a\u003e\u003c\/p\u003e\n\n \u003cp\u003eFrederic Edwin Church (1826-1900), the greatest exponent of the so-called Hudson River School, used to travel much of the year to unknown territories in order to become familiar with nature and take notes for his paintings. Inspired by the study trips of Humboldt—the German scientist and humanist—he undertook various journeys that took him to various places in the world. Among these, in 1853, he toured remote and exotic places in Colombia and Ecuador. This book provides innovative documentation of the trip and shows for the first time to the world most of the sketches and drawings made during that journey, which reside in the Cooper-Hewitt Museum in New York. Pablo Navas Sanz de Santamaría's extensive research for this study reveals ignored plastic and human facets of the painter. His surprising work constitutes a valuable testimony of the people, life and customs of these countries at the beginning of the second half of the 19th century.\u003c\/p\u003e","brand":"Villegas Asociados S.A","offers":[{"title":"Default Title","offer_id":31910222528570,"sku":"9789588306261","price":245000.0,"currency_code":"COP","in_stock":true}],"thumbnail_url":"\/\/cdn.shopify.com\/s\/files\/1\/0258\/8924\/3194\/products\/Fredt.jpg?v=1623446483"},{"product_id":"gerardo-aragon-infinite-dimension","title":"Gerardo Aragon (English)","description":"\u003cmeta charset=\"utf-8\"\u003e\n\n\u003cp\u003e \u003cstrong\u003eAlso available in Spanish with the title:\u003c\/strong\u003e \u003ca title=\"Gerardo Aragon\" href=\"https:\/\/villegaseditores.com\/products\/gerardo-aragon\"\u003eGerardo Aragón\u003c\/a\u003e\u003c\/p\u003e\n\n\u003cp\u003e \u003ca title=\"Gerardo Aragon\" href=\"https:\/\/villegaseditores.com\/products\/gerardo-aragon\"\u003e\u003cimg style=\"display: block; margin-left: auto; margin-right: auto;\" alt=\"\" src=\"https:\/\/cdn.shopify.com\/s\/files\/1\/0258\/8924\/3194\/files\/gerardo_240x240.jpg?v=1597990331\"\u003e\u003c\/a\u003e\u003c\/p\u003e\n\n\u003cp\u003e Gerardo Aragón belonged to that generation of Colombian artists that developed under the influence of pop and abstract expressionism in the mid-sixties of the last century.
